LabelImg is a graphical image annotation tool. This project is not updated with new functions now. More functions are supported with LabelImgTool Project(https://github.com/lzx1413/LabelImgTool)

It is written in Python and uses Qt for its graphical interface.

The annotation file will be saved as an XML file. The annotation format is PASCAL VOC format, and the format is the same as ImageNet

Usage

After cloning the code, you should run $ make all to generate the resource file.

You can then start annotating by running $ ./labelImg.py. For usage instructions you can see Here

At the moment annotations are saved as an XML file. The format is PASCAL VOC format, and the format is the same as ImageNet

You can also see ImageNet Utils to download image, create a label text for machine learning, etc

Label and parsing

support rectangle label and parsing labels

Create pre-defined classes

You can edit the data/predefined_classes.txt to load pre-defined classes

You also can create labels with two levels in data/predefined_sub_classes.txt

And the labels will be ranked by the frequency you use it.

General steps from scratch

  • Build and launch: $ make all; python labelImg.py

  • Click 'Change default saved annotation folder' in Menu/File

  • Click 'Open Dir'

  • Click 'Create RectBox'

The annotation will be saved to the folder you specifiy

Hotkeys

  • Ctrl + r : Change the defult target dir which saving annotation files

  • Ctrl + n : Create a bounding box

  • Ctrl + s : Save

  • Right : Next image

  • Left : Previous image
